Lecturer, University of East London

Kiran Patel is a Lecturer in Computing and Digital Technologies at the University of East London, technology educator, industry practitioner and community activator passionate about using technology to create opportunity, develop future skills and solve real-world problems.

With experience spanning primary school coding clubs too higher education, web development, digital transformation, AI, emerging technologies and community innovation, Kiran works at the intersection of education and industry. His approach is strongly focused on moving beyond theoretical learning and creating practical opportunities for learners to build, experiment, collaborate and develop solutions to genuine challenges.

Kiran leads and supports a range of initiatives connecting students, staff, industry, and local communities, including the CDT Maker Club, digital skills programmes, industry-facing projects, and mentoring activities. Through these initiatives, learners gain hands-on experience across areas such as AI, coding, web technologies programming, digital fabrication, electronics, 3D printing, and emerging technology.

A strong advocate for AI and future technical skills, Kiran is particularly interested in how education can prepare learners for a rapidly changing world of work while ensuring that emerging technologies remain accessible, responsible, and useful. He champions learning models that connect technical knowledge with creativity, employability, entrepreneurship, and problem-solving.

Kiran also brings an industry perspective through his work as a web development and digital technology practitioner, helping bridge the gap between what learners' study and the technologies, practices, and expectations they encounter beyond university.

His work has been recognised through university teaching and learning awards, including recognition for Careers-Led Teaching and Learning, and he continues to develop innovative approaches to connecting education with industry and communities.

As a Bett 2027 Ambassador, Kiran is keen to contribute to conversations around AI in education, future skills, digital inclusion, practical technology education, employability, and the role of educators in shaping the next generation of digital innovators. He is particularly interested in sharing what works in practice, challenging conventional approaches and connecting people across education, technology, industry, and the wider community.
